What does the word "Catocala" mean?

The word "Catocala" refers to a genus of moths belonging to the family Erebidae, commonly known as the underwing moths. These fascinating creatures have captured the attention of both entomologists and casual observers alike due to their striking appearances and behaviors. The name "Catocala" itself is derived from Greek roots, which offers insights into the characteristics of these moths.

Intriguingly, the term "Catocala" can be broken down into two parts: "cato-" and "-cala." The prefix "cato-" is a transformation of the Greek word "katá," which means "down" or "beneath." The suffix "-cala" comes from a variation of the Greek "kalos," meaning "beautiful." Thus, when combined, "Catocala" can be interpreted as "beautiful beneath," which is particularly apt given the moths' unique coloring and patterns.

Most species within the Catocala genus are known for their strikingly colorful hindwings, which are often hidden while they rest. When they are disturbed, these moths reveal their vibrant underwings, which range in color from shades of red, orange, and yellow to more muted tones, depending on the species. Their common name, "underwing moths," directly refers to this fascinating feature.
